The first piano festival in the City of Music Pianofortissimo, the international piano festival started up by Inedita in 2013, is a truly unique part of Bologna’s music history, as such an event dedicated to piano had never been organised despite the city’s long-standing piano tradition. Inedita chose to celebrate this significant heritage as well as Unesco's recognition of the city as Creative City of Music. The excellent results obtained during the previous six editions (2013-2018) confirm the uniqueness and importance of the objective that has always been at the heart of the event, whilst making it particularly important within the music events organized in Bologna.
